FrieslandCampina Ingredients’ Vivinal® MFGM approved for use in Thailand

February 4, 2025 by Asia Food Journal

Vivinal

Courtesy of FrieslandCampina Ingredients

FrieslandCampina Ingredients, a global leader in proteins and prebiotics, has received approval for its milk fat globule membrane (MFGM) ingredient, Vivinal®MFGM, for use in infant milk formulas and other food products in Thailand. This milestone follows a comprehensive three-year evaluation by Thailand’s Food and Drug Administration (TFDA). 

Vivinal® MFGM – a premium whey protein concentrate obtained through the gentle processing of pasteurised cheese whey – contains proteins, lipids, and bioactive components such as phospholipids, immunoglobulin G (IgG), and lactoferrin. Clinical evidence shows that MFGM supports infants’ cognitive development and reduces the risk of middle ear infections.[i],[ii] Additionally, a recent in vitro study conducted by FrieslandCampina Ingredients was the first to show that whey-derived MFGM has anti-viral effects against respiratory syncytial virus (RSV).[iii]

This latest approval means manufacturers of premium nutrition for babies and young children in Thailand can now offer Vivinal® MFGM’s science-backed benefits in a wide range of infant and young child food applications. It also underscores FrieslandCampina Ingredients’ position as a trusted leader in early life nutrition, dedicated to providing innovative solutions that support the health and development of infants worldwide.

“We’re delighted that our Vivinal® MFGM ingredient has received approval from Thailand’s Food and Drug Administration,” says Sophie Nicolas, Marketing Lead APAC – Early Life Nutrition at FrieslandCampina Ingredients. “This achievementF not only emphasises our commitment to meeting rigorous safety standards but also offers brands the exciting opportunity to create premium infant milk formulas for the growing Thai market, with all the added health benefits this premium ingredient with bioactive proteins offers.”

The premiumization of infant milk formula is a growing trend in Thailand. In 2024, 74% of new infant milk formula product launches contained at least one bioactive ingredient[iv] –  like Vivinal® MFGM. The infant milk formula market in Thailand is valued at $865 million USD in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 5% through 2029.[v]

“Introducing this premium ingredient to brands in Thailand supports our mission to provide important nutrition that supports babies’ and children’s healthy growth and development,” adds Sophie. “Families deserve access to the highest-quality infant milk formula when breastfeeding is not possible – and with this approval, we’re able to help brands provide more infants with the nutrients they need for a great start in life.”

About FrieslandCampina Ingredients 

FrieslandCampina Ingredients is a leader in proteins and prebiotics, addressing the growing need for innovative nutritional solutions to the world’s health and well-being challenges. Its drive is to get the right ingredients to customers to help them create highly nutritious, sustainable applications to help people with special dietary needs and preferences get the most out of life, always.   

Powered by 1,700 passionate specialists, FrieslandCampina Ingredients operates globally across the Early Life Nutrition, Active, Performance, Medical and Cell Nutrition market segments. The company has regional sales offices in the Netherlands, the United States, Singapore, China, and Brazil. It reported combined sales of €1.65 billion in 2022. For additional information, please visit: www.frieslandcampinaingredients.com.        

FrieslandCampina Ingredients is part of Royal FrieslandCampina N.V. The dairy company daily provides millions of consumers throughout the world with dairy products containing valuable nutrients from milk. The company is fully owned by Zuivelcoöperatie FrieslandCampina U.A., with 15,137 dairy farmers in the Netherlands, Belgium, and Germany as members. Its annual turnover amounted to €14.1 billion in 2022. FrieslandCampina has locations in 31 countries and exports to more than one hundred countries worldwide. In 2022, FrieslandCampina employed an average of 21,715 employees (FTEs). Its head office is located in the Netherlands.
